[S1M-675.4 (Amendment)] Decision Time — 23 Mar 2000 at 17:13
This looks like the vote on S1M-675.4
The description in the bulletin on 2000-03-23 is:
*S1M-675.4 Robin Harper: Genetic Modification Science—As an amendment to motion (S1M-675) in the name of Susan Deacon, leave out from "commends" to end and insert "recognises the excellence of the Scottish biotechnology industry and calls on the Enterprise, Culture and Sport, Rural Affairs and Transport and the Environment Committees to report to the Parliament on the full implications of planting GM crops in Scotland for our economy, agriculture and environment." Supported by: Dennis Canavan*, Donald Gorrie*
You can search for this motion (S1M-675.4) on TheyWorkForYou
Text Introducing Division:
The sixth question is, that amendment S1M-675.4, in the name of Robin Harper, which seeks to amend motion S1M-675, in the name of Susan Deacon, on genetic modification science, be agreed to. Are we agreed?
No.
There will be a division.
Party Summary
Votes by party, red entries are votes against the majority for that party.
Party | Majority (No) | Minority (Aye) | Abstentions | Turnout |
Con | 0 | 0 | 16 | 84.2% |
Green | 0 | 1 | 0 | 100.0% |
Independent | 0 | 3 | 0 | 100.0% |
Lab | 43 | 1 | 2 | 83.6% |
LDem | 10 | 2 | 1 | 81.3% |
SNP | 0 | 29 | 0 | 87.9% |
Total: | 53 | 36 | 19 | 85.0% |
